About Dakota Staton

1950s jazz artist who gained national fame for her 1957 #4 hit single “The Late, Late Show.”

Early Life of Dakota Staton

She started performing in local night clubs at the age of eighteen.

She was also known for the albums In the Night, Dynamic!, and Dakota at Storyville.

Family Life

She was briefly married to trumpeter Talib Dawud and had a brother named Fred who played the saxophone.

Associated With

She was featured in the documentary Jazzwomen with Etta Jones in 2000.
